Legal Affairs and Insurance

The sub-series is divided in two subsub-series on the legal procedures taken by Vineberg against Samuel Novick Inc., a truck company, after an accident in New York City which caused physical diseases to himself and his wife and on his insurances claims and couverture.

Financing and Donations

Sub-series consists of nineteen files of documents related to the financing of research work of Dr. Vineberg. We can find a file on the legal constitution of the Vineberg Heart Foundation through which Vineberg accumulates private donations. There are files on donations and also requests of contributions to previous patients, individuals, companies and politicians.
Includes thank you letters, solicitation letters, newspaper clippings, list of donors, memorandums, notebook, one report of the House of Commons Debates, copy of charter, notes, one last will and testament, drafts of letters, articles.

Reprints

Subseries contains copies of reprints published by Arthur Vineberg in scientific and medical journals and chapters of books on which Vineberg collaborated. It covers all his career but more specifically after 1950 until 1975. These reprints reflect the progress of Vineberg's work and his findings on myocardial revascularization. Subseries contains 98 files, arranged by date of publication.
Includes reprints and photocopies.

Memorabilia

This sub-series consists of varied materials including maps, event programs, newspaper clippings, travel itineraries, and other souvenirs collected by Helen to commemorate events, experiences, or places visited throughout her life with Wilder. This sub-series includes materials collection by Helen from her service in the war, her life in England, her travels with Wilder, and her varied social activities in Montreal. This sub-series also contains Helen’s detailed family chronicle spanning the years 1921-1963, and a biographical sketch of Wilder, written in 1956.
